database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
ㆍOrac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Oracle Q&A 39221 게시물 읽기
No. 39221
데이터베이스 튜닝을 해야되는데 간단한 인덱스 질문입니다.
작성자
윤명철(nidty)
작성일
2012-01-11 13:55
조회수
4,017

울 프로젝트 구성원중에 db에 뛰어난분이 안계셔서 내가 어느정도는 튜닝을 해줘야될텐데

우선 생각하는게 ~

날자가 있는 데이터에 날자에 인덱스를 걸고자 합니다.

날자는 varchar2 인데

이정도 튜닝만으로도 어느정도 성능향상을 기대할수 있겠죠 ?

그외에 거의 모든페이지에 쓰이는 품목테이블이나 기타 다른것도 걸고 싶은데 전체를 걸기는 뭐하고 그래서

보류중입니다.

그외에 튜닝팁 같은게 있으면 조언부탁드립니다.

이 글에 대한 댓글이 총 2건 있습니다.

 

- 인덱스가 부재한 상황이면서

- 조회조건에 날자가(대부분) 오는 경우

> 적합한 튜닝 방법니다.

단. 주의사항은 

- 인덱스에서 날자 컬럼의 위치와 

ex) ix(조건1, 날자) 또는 ix(날짜, 조건1) 에 선택 고려

- 통계정보가 항상 최신이거나, Hint 를 SQL문내 고정하도록 유도 해야 합니다.

 

그 밖에 튜닝 팩트로.

- 집합의 범위를 줄여주는 조건 (필수, 옵션 등)

- 조건에 항상 오는 컬럼위주로 인덱스 생성

- 관련 SQL모두 확인하기

등 입니다.

tohappy(tohappy)님이 2012-01-11 17:39에 작성한 댓글입니다.

답변 감사합니다.

이제 마무리단계라 정신이 없습니다.

윤명철님이 2012-01-11 17:48에 작성한 댓글입니다. Edit
[Top]
No.
제목
작성자
작성일
조회
39225쿼리는 질문있어요 ㅜㅜ [3]
정진히
2012-01-11
4118
39224두 날짜사이의 월 구하는 쿼리 GROUP BY 질문입니다. [2]
박주영
2012-01-11
4951
39223다시 한번 더 부탁드립니다. (초 응급 상황) [2]
순이
2012-01-11
3878
39221데이터베이스 튜닝을 해야되는데 간단한 인덱스 질문입니다. [2]
윤명철
2012-01-11
4017
39220로그 남기기 [1]
초보자
2012-01-11
3576
39219쿼리 질문드려요^^ [1]
김진
2012-01-10
3559
39217이런건 어떻게 구할까요? [3]
김종태
2012-01-10
3947
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.018초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다